I bought a used, mint Smith and Wesson model
66-1 with 2 1/2 inch barrel with these grips:
http://www.getgrip.com/images/softrubber/revolvers/KBantam%20Grip.jpg
The gun wouldn't fire my reloads reliably so I ordered a new mainspring from Wolff.
Only I'd never taken the grips off. And it didn't come with any tools to take them off.
So, after two ripped thumbnails and one chipped tooth, I got those suckers off.
Turns out it didn't need a new mainspring. Some idiot had simply backed the mainspring screw out about four turns.
But I'll never put those grips back on.
